Поддерживает ли Janusgraph тип данных Blob? - PullRequest
0 голосов
/ 30 января 2019

Я использую janusgraph над cassandra и упругим поиском.В cassadra blob поддерживается тип данных для сохранения файлов.

Мой вопрос:

Поддерживается ли в janusgraph обработка и сохранение файлов в виде больших двоичных объектов, и может ли кто-нибудь дать мне пример Java или API для этого?

1 Ответ

0 голосов
/ 30 января 2019

JanusGraph поддерживает следующие типы данных:

  • Байт
  • Short
  • Integer
  • Long
  • Float
  • Двойной
  • Строка
  • Географическая форма
  • Дата
  • Мгновенная
  • UUID

К сожалениюBLOB не является одним из них.

Следует иметь в виду, что хранение свойств внутри JanusGraph может быть сложным.Например, свойства ребер хранятся в обеих вершинах, что означает, что они хранятся дважды.Короче говоря, вы должны стараться, чтобы стоимость вашей недвижимости была как можно меньше;и BLOB работают против этого принципа.

И FWIW, хранение больших файлов как BLOB также не является хорошей идеей в Кассандре.Лучший вариант - сохранить ссылку на файл и заставить приложение искать его отдельно.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...